What is a Fire Safety Certificate?

A fire safety certificate is a document that certifies that a building has met all the necessary fire safety regulations. It is issued by the local fire department or the building control authority. It is important to note that a fire safety certificate is different from a fire safety assessment.

Why is a Fire Safety Certificate Important?

A fire safety certificate is important because it ensures that the building is safe for occupancy. It certifies that the building has met all the necessary fire safety regulations and that the occupants will be safe in case of a fire. It is also important for insurance purposes.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Who issues a fire safety certificate?

A fire safety certificate is issued by the local fire department or the building control authority.

2. Is a fire safety certificate different from a fire safety assessment?

Yes, a fire safety certificate is different from a fire safety assessment. A fire safety assessment is an evaluation of the fire risks in a building, while a fire safety certificate certifies that the building has met all the necessary fire safety regulations.

3. How often should a fire safety certificate be renewed?

A fire safety certificate is typically valid for one to three years, depending on the local regulations. It should be renewed before it expires.

4. Is a fire safety certificate required for residential buildings?

It depends on the local regulations. In some areas, a fire safety certificate is required for residential buildings, while in others, it is only required for commercial buildings.

5. How much does a fire safety certificate cost?

The cost of a fire safety certificate varies depending on the location and the size of the building. It is best to contact the local fire department or building control authority to get an accurate estimate.

What is a Building Safety Certificate?

A building safety certificate is a document that certifies that a building is safe for occupancy. This certificate is issued by the local government or a third-party inspector after the building has undergone a safety inspection. The certificate provides assurance to the occupants that the building meets the required safety standards and is safe for them to live or work in.

Format of Building Safety Certificate

In the year 2023, the format of building safety certificates has undergone some changes. The format now includes the following details:

1. Building Information

The first section of the certificate includes information about the building. This includes the address, the type of building, and the number of floors. This information is crucial as it helps to identify the building in case of any emergency.

2. Safety Inspection Details

The second section of the certificate includes details of the safety inspection that was carried out. This includes the name of the inspector, the date of the inspection, and the findings of the inspection. Any safety hazards identified during the inspection will also be listed in this section.

3. Safety Measures

The third section of the certificate includes details of the safety measures that have been put in place to address any safety hazards identified during the inspection. This includes details of any repairs or renovations that were carried out to ensure that the building is safe for occupancy.

4. Expiration Date

The final section of the certificate includes the expiration date of the certificate. This is the date by which the building owner must renew the certificate to ensure that the building remains safe for occupancy.

What is a Safety Management Certificate?

A safety management certificate is a document issued by an accredited organization that provides evidence that employers have taken steps to ensure the safety of their employees. It is designed to demonstrate to employers, employees, and government agencies that an organization is meeting the applicable health and safety standards. The certificate is usually issued after an inspection of the organization’s safety practices, and is valid for a specific period of time.

Types of Safety Management Certificates

There are several types of safety management certificates available in 2023. These include:

1. OSHA Certification

The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) requires employers to have a safety management system in place that meets certain standards. An OSHA certification is evidence that an organization is meeting the applicable standards and has taken adequate steps to ensure the safety of its employees.

2. ISO 45001 Certification

ISO 45001 is an international standard for occupational health and safety management systems. It is designed to help organizations identify, manage and reduce risks associated with workplace hazards. An ISO 45001 certification is evidence that an organization is meeting the requirements of the standard and taking steps to ensure the safety of its workers.

3. MSHA Certification

The Mine Safety and Health Administration (MSHA) requires that all mines meet specific safety standards. An MSHA certification is evidence that an organization is meeting the applicable safety standards and taking adequate steps to ensure the safety of its employees.
